Prime Minister Narendra Modi is scheduled to visit Bihar on May 4, 2025, to inaugurate the Khelo India Youth Games (KIYG) at the Patliputra Sports Complex in Patna. This marks Bihar's first time hosting the national multi-sport event, which will run until May 15 across five cities: Patna, Gaya, Rajgir, Bhagalpur, and Begusarai.
The visit highlights the government's focus on promoting sports development and encouraging young talent in the country. By inaugurating the Khelo India Youth Games, Prime Minister Modi will be emphasizing the importance of sports in shaping the nation's youth and fostering a culture of fitness and excellence.

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ar has been actively overseeing preparations for the games, including reviewing facilities at the Patliputra Sports Complex. The mascot for KIYG 2025, "Gajsimha," symbolizes strength and courage, drawing inspiration from the state's rich cultural heritage.

Khelo India Youth Games- A flagship program by Government of India
The Khelo India Youth Games is a flagship program initiated by the Government of India to promote sports and fitness among the youth. The event aims to identify and nurture talented young athletes, providing them with a platform to showcase their skills and compete at the national level.
